The Mechanics of Electronic Signatures

Electronic signatures use unique identifiers, such as passwords or biometric data, to authenticate the signer’s identity. This ensures that the signature is secure and tamper-proof. Most e-signature platforms use encryption and multi-factor authentication to protect sensitive information.

How Electronic Signatures Work

Here’s a step-by-step guide on how to create electronic signatures:

  • Choose a reliable e-signature platform, such as Adobe Sign or DocuSign, that meets your needs and compliance requirements.

  • Upload the document you want to sign, or create a new one within the platform.

  • Select the fields that require signatures and add your signature using your chosen method, such as a mouse or touch signature.

  • Add any additional information, such as your name, phone number, or email address, as required.

  • Send the document to the recipient or recipients, who can then review, sign, and return it to you.

  • Once the document is signed and returned, it is stored securely in your account for easy access and reference.

Common Curiosities: Debunking Myths

Electronic signatures are often misunderstood or associated with myths. Let’s address some common concerns:

  • Myth: Electronic signatures are not secure.

    Reality: Reputable e-signature platforms use encryption and multi-factor authentication to protect sensitive information.

  • Myth: Electronic signatures are not legally binding.

    Reality: In most jurisdictions, e-signatures have the same legal weight as handwritten signatures, provided they meet certain regulations and guidelines.

  • Myth: Electronic signatures are expensive.

    Reality: Many e-signature platforms offer affordable pricing plans, including free trials and competitive rates for businesses and individuals.
